AIM atmosphere interface S/R for exchanges with the coupler.

1 jmc 1.1 C $Header: $
2     C $Name: $
3    
4     #include "CPP_OPTIONS.h"
5    
6     CStartOfInterface
7     SUBROUTINE CPL_IMPORT_EXTERNAL_DATA(
8     I myCurrentIter, myCurrentTime, myThid )
9     C /==========================================================\
10     C | SUBROUTINE CPL_IMPORT_EXTERNAL_DATA |
11     C | o Routine for controlling import of coupling data from |
12     C | coupler layer. |
13     C |==========================================================|
14     C | This version talks to the MIT Coupler. It uses the MIT |
15     C | Coupler "checkpoint1" library calls. |
16     C \==========================================================/
17     IMPLICIT NONE
18    
19     #include "EEPARAMS.h"
20     #include "CPL_PARAMS.h"
21    
22     C == Routine arguments ==
23     C myCurrentIter - Current timestep number.
24     C myCurrentTime - Current internal time.
25     C myThid - Thread number for this instance
26     C of the routine.
27     INTEGER myCurrentIter
28     _RL myCurrentTime
29     INTEGER myThid
30     CEndOfInterface
31    
32     C == Local variables ==
33    
34     C Fetch data from coupling layer. Note MIT Coupler checkpoint1
35     C does not allow asynchronous extraction of data, so ordering
36     C has to be consistent with ordering coupling layer.
37     c IF ( (myCurrentIter/96)*96 .EQ. myCurrentIter ) THEN
38     IF ( (myCurrentIter/cplSendFrq_iter)*cplSendFrq_iter
39     & .EQ. myCurrentIter ) THEN
40     WRITE(0,*) ' Importing fluxes at iteration ', myCurrentIter
41     CALL ATM_IMPORT_SST ( myThid )
42     ENDIF
43    
44     RETURN
45     END
